CSDN首页 空间 新闻 论坛 Blog 下载 读书 网摘 搜索 .NET Java 视频 接项目 求职 在线学习 买书 程序员 通知
IBM Rational 系统开发最佳实践工具包 WebSphere MQ 最佳实践 TOP 15
CSDN社区
搜索 收藏 打印 关闭
CSDN社区 >  Web 开发 >  ASP

删除access的问题~````

楼主ywuque(花无缺)2006-03-10 12:22:16 在 Web 开发 / ASP 提问

example6:  
  <form   name="form1"   method="post"   action="example72.asp">  
  delete:    
  <input   type="text"   name="id">  
  <input   type="submit"   name="Submit"   value="提交">  
  </form>  
   
  example72:  
  <%  
  set   conn=server.createobject("adodb.connection")  
  conn.open   "driver={microsoft   access   driver   (*.mdb)};dbq="&server.mappath("example3.mdb")  
  exec="select   *   from   guestbook   where   id="&request("id")  
   
  set   rs=server.createobject("adodb.recordset")  
  rs.open   exec,conn,1,1    
  %>  
  <form   name="form"   method="post"   action="example7.asp">  
  <table   width="100%"   border="0"   cellspacing="0"   cellpadding="0">  
   
  <%  
  do   while   not   rs.eof  
  %><tr>  
  <td><%=rs("id")%></td>  
  <td><%=rs("name")%></td>  
  <td><%=rs("tel")%></td>  
  <td><%=rs("message")%></td>  
  </tr>  
  <tr>  
  <td>  
  <input   type="submit"   name="submit"   value="提交">  
  </td>  
  </tr>  
  </form>  
  <%  
  rs.movenext  
  loop  
  %>  
  </table>  
   
  example7:  
  <%  
  set   conn=server.createobject("adodb.connection")  
  conn.open   "driver={microsoft   access   driver   (*.mdb)};dbq="&server.mappath("example3.mdb")  
  exec="delete   *   from   guestbook   where   id="&request("id")  
   
  conn.execute   exec  
  response.write   "删除成功!"  
  %>  
  这个example7里面的exec="delete   *   from   guestbook   where   id="&request("id")  
  这个="&request("id")里的id想要调用example6里的id,怎么调用? 问题点数:20、回复次数:4Top

1 楼lovexpshl(白浪)回复于 2006-03-10 12:26:44 得分 15

在example72中的  
  <form   name="form"   method="post"   action="example7.asp">  
  改成  
  <form   name="form"   method="post"   action="example7.asp?id=<%=rs("id")%>">  
   
  原理id的值由example6中的id传到example72中,再由example72传到example7中Top

2 楼Cooly(☆不做开发很久了......☆)回复于 2006-03-10 12:27:21 得分 0

-_-;;  
   
  <form   name="form1"   method="post"   action="example7.asp">  
  delete:    
  <input   type="text"   name="id">  
  <input   type="submit"   name="Submit"   value="提交">  
  </form>  
   
  example7:   这个文件名是example7.asp  
  <%  
  set   conn=server.createobject("adodb.connection")  
  conn.open   "driver={microsoft   access   driver   (*.mdb)};dbq="&server.mappath("example3.mdb")  
  exec="delete   *   from   guestbook   where   id="&request("id")  
   
  conn.execute   exec  
  response.write   "删除成功!"  
  %>  
  Top

3 楼R_Kill(圣御飞侠)回复于 2006-03-10 12:30:29 得分 5

在example6   做个<input   type="hidden"   name="ver"   value="<%=id%>">Top

4 楼ywuque(花无缺)回复于 2006-03-10 12:46:12 得分 0

会了,谢谢Top

相关问题

  • access文件拷贝、删除问题: 无法删除?
  • 物理删除记录!ADO 连接 ACCESS
  • access是否支持多表删除?
  • 关于Access数据库删除问题?
  • ACCESS数据库的删除问题
  • 删除adoquery1.Delete数据??access数据库
  • access数据库不能删除
  • Access 出现 "#已删除" 错误?
  • Access 出现 "#已删除" 错误?
  • Access 删除记录的问题!

关键词

  • 调用
  • example
  • request

得分解答快速导航

  • 帖主:ywuque
  • lovexpshl
  • R_Kill

相关链接

  • Web开发类图书

广告也精彩

反馈

请通过下述方式给我们反馈
反馈
提问
网站简介|广告服务|VIP资费标准|银行汇款帐号|网站地图|帮助|联系方式|诚聘英才|English|问题报告
北京创新乐知广告有限公司 版权所有, 京 ICP 证 070598 号
世纪乐知(北京)网络技术有限公司 提供技术支持
Copyright © 2000-2008, CSDN.NET, All Rights Reserved
GongshangLogo